About Prince & Pilgrim Gallery
Walking in, you'll find rotating exhibitions that lean towards emerging artists and experimental work. The scale is intimate, which means you're not trudging around for hours feeling obligated to care about everything on the walls. Most visits run to about 45 minutes unless something really grabs you. The space itself feels lived-in rather than sterile, which some will love and others might find a touch rough around the edges.
It's worth knowing admission details aren't readily publicised online, so ring ahead or just turn up and ask - that kind of approachability is part of the charm. Families with older kids who actually engage with art will get more from it than toddlers, and it's the sort of stop that works brilliantly alongside a broader South East day out. If you're based at Walton on Thames Camping and Caravanning Club Site, it's easily reachable for an afternoon wander. Don't expect blockbuster shows or the National Gallery treatment, but if you're hunting for something genuine in the local art scene, it's worth the visit.
